Percentage of enrolment in upper secondary education in private in Eritrea
Eritrea: Percentage of enrolment in upper secondary education in private was 51.9% in 2018. ▲ Rising
Percentage of enrolment in upper secondary education in private in Eritrea, 1999–2018
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
The most recent figure for percentage of enrolment in upper secondary education in private in Eritrea is 51.9%, measured in 2018.
The figure is down 0.7% on the previous year and up 19.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, percentage of enrolment in upper secondary education in private in Eritrea peaked at 53.4% in 1999 and was at its lowest, 33.2%, in 2006.
Eritrea ranks 67th of 168 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 18 years of available data.
Percentage of enrolment in upper secondary education in private in Eritrea,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1999 | 53.4% | — |
| 2000 | 53.1% | -0.5% |
| 2001 | 44.9% | -15.5% |
| 2002 | 40.5% | -9.7% |
| 2003 | 40.5% | -0.2% |
| 2004 | 35.4% | -12.5% |
| 2005 | 34.6% | -2.2% |
| 2006 | 33.2% | -4.0% |
| 2007 | 41.1% | +23.5% |
| 2008 | 43.6% | +6.1% |
| 2009 | 44.2% | +1.4% |
| 2010 | 46.8% | +5.9% |
| 2011 | 46.4% | -0.8% |
| 2013 | 46.3% | -0.3% |
| 2014 | 49.4% | +6.8% |
| 2015 | 51.0% | +3.2% |
| 2017 | 52.3% | +2.6% |
| 2018 | 51.9% | -0.7% |
